1/18/22 COVID 19 Report Monday

18 January 2022 News


With the new reporting method for people who test positive for COVID-19 a backlog of cases continues to flood in along with new results putting the 7-day rolling average for new cases at 17,916 on Monday. But those numbers may be slowing down with the average dropping by more than 1,800 cases since last Friday. The state’s Department of Health Services yesterday also reported 54 more deaths putting the death toll since the pandemic began at 10,540 lives lost. The state also reported 757 more hospitalizations over the weekend. The Wisconsin Hospital Association says 2,247 people are hospitalized around the state with COVID and 452 of those patients are in intensive care units.

Winnebago County Monday reported 1,255 new COVID-19 cases and 1 death. Fond du Lac County surpassed 25,000 total cases with 768 new cases since Friday giving it a total of 25,556 cases. Dodge County moved past 21,000 cases (21,125) reporting 808 new cases and 6 deaths and Green Lake County had 76 new cases. Waupaca County recorded 185 new cases and is nearing 10,000 total cases (9,899) and Waushara County had 120 new cases of the coronavirus.
